Creator of Collection Unknown : Photographs from an album of Ross and the Franz Joseph Glacier

Date
ca 1870s
Reference
PAColl-7479
Description

Francis Joseph (sic) Glacier near the outlet of the Wai-au River; tabular flume, Donolly Creek, Ross height 98 feet length 800 feet - a flume supported on poles above the creek; Aylmer Street, Ross showing the Junction Hotel, Dunedin Hotel, and Dr Bush's consulting rooms in front of the Morning Star mining claim; the viaduct from the creek at Ross height 167 feet; Bond Street, Ross with a church and what may be the Star Bakery in the foreground and along the street from the left, Provincial Hotel, J Manson & Co, Shamrock Hotel, Gay and Green Hall of Commerce, Bank of New Zealand(?), Post Office, Post Office Hotel, a wholesale wine merchants and the Camp Hotel; and the few buildings of Lagoon Town between Ross and Hokitika. Photographer unidentified.

Ross, West Coast

Date: 1870

From: Creator of Collection Unknown : Photographs from an album of Ross and the Franz Joseph Glacier

Reference: 1/2-004648-F

Description: Township of Ross, West Coast, in 1870, with the north east side of Aylmer Street in the foreground, and an alluvial gold mine behind. View includes the Dunedin Hotel. Photographer unidentified. Other - Notes on back of file print include "Morning Star Claim" Other - Similar view at 1/2-017897 Source of descriptive information - Notes on file print.
